Welcome Jurassitol.
This series can hold up to 128GB Memory.
 
I use a 64gb Sandisk Endurance card. Mainly because they're designed with DashCams in mind so can sustain high constant writes.

But any decent SD card will be fine. They might fail slightly earlier that's all.

No idea about your charger.

Motion Detection is too sensitive. Leaves in the wind will set it off. So for parking mode I have the motion detection turned off and the g sensor turned up.

Revert to firmware V1.009 when you get it. This is what I did. The cloud feature is a nice idea but is a bit buggy at the moment. There is a V2.001 firmware out but I haven't tried that just yet.

Have you tested the Gsensor? Like shoving your car etc? I too would have a problem with the camera constantly running. As my vehicle is pointed at the neigborhood road.
 
Yes. G sensor works well.

Someone "keying" your car is going to be along side, unless you have motion detection on he (she?) will not be caught on your camera. Even if your camera sees them approaching how do you prove it was them? Could easily be argued that they.. were just passing by. If.. you seriously want to catch someone damaging your car a dash cam is not the tool to use.
